This SPECLITE pole top luminaire utilizes advanced LED technology to deliver outstanding performance while consuming significantly less energy than traditional HID or metal halide fixtures. The selectable wattage and color temperature feature is built directly into the driver, allowing installers to configure the fixture on-site without the need for additional components. This means one fixture can serve a variety of applications, reducing inventory complexity and ensuring optimal light quality for each unique installation.
At the heart of this fixture is a high-efficiency LED driver with 0-10V dimming capability, ensuring smooth and flicker-free light adjustment across the full dimming range. The driver is designed to operate across a broad input voltage range, making it compatible with a wide variety of Canadian residential and commercial electrical systems. A high CRI rating ensures that colors appear natural and true under the light, enhancing visibility and safety around your property.
Thermal performance is critical to LED longevity, and this fixture features a robust thermal management system with a die-cast aluminum housing that efficiently dissipates heat away from the LED array. This design helps maintain consistent light output and extends the overall lifespan of the fixture well beyond that of conventional lighting technologies. The unit is IP-rated for wet locations, ensuring dependable operation through rain, snow, ice, and the full range of Canadian weather extremes.
This pole top light is cUL listed and DLC certified, qualifying it for many utility rebate programs across Canada and confirming that it meets rigorous standards for energy efficiency and safety. Installation is straightforward, with a standard pole-top mounting configuration and an integrated photocell-ready base that supports automatic dusk-to-dawn operation. Compared to legacy lighting systems, upgrading to this LED fixture can result in energy savings of up to 70% or more, reducing both electricity costs and environmental impact for years to come.
